What’s the Challenge?
So, what’s the big problem here? Traditional farming methods are like a Flip phone in a smartphone world. Farmers often wrestle with a multitude of equipment that don’t communicate with each other—a real recipe for disaster. Integrating a precision agriculture guidance system can eliminate these hidden headaches by centralizing data and insights. Lessons Learned: A Farming Philosophy
My journey in agriculture has taught me to never underestimate the power of innovation. A few metrics to consider before diving into precision agriculture: determine your yield goals (aim for those high-hanging fruits!), evaluate the compatibility of your equipment (no square pegs in round holes), and assess the ROI you can expect (because, yes, profits matter!).
